Diabetes Ignored: Krystin's Life details Krystin's struggle, in her own words, with her failure at diabetes management written over the course of her life. The book draws on her diaries, email and text messages, blogs, and Facebook posts, from high school through college, her travels, and her work. It tells her stories of frequent visits to the hospital, her organ transplants, and the pain and medical problems that accumulate as she gets older, including gastroparesis, esophageal stents, cataract surgery, and opioid addiction. Her narrative is heart-wrenching, heart-warming, uplifting, and depressing. The book also illuminates her parents' struggle with Krystin's diabetes from the time she was diagnosed at age 4 until she died at age 32. Krystin's humor shows up but so does the distinction between her public persona (such as on Facebook) and her private anguish both at the medical issues as well as her inability to deal with her disease.
